Why Twitter is a Target
by Andrew McCaskey
If there is politics in the air, some Air Cover is needed.
That’s my only conclusion regarding the draft US Army intelligence report that has identified the micro-blogging service Twitter as a potential terrorist tool.
It makes for a great headline. The report identified the popular micro-blogging service Twitter, Global Positioning System maps and voice-changing software as potential terrorist tools. Some of the less obvious tools that were not in the report included automobiles, public transit, cellphones and libraries. The report outlined scenarios in which militants could make use of Twitter, combined with such programs as Google Maps or cell phone pictures or video, to carry out an ambush or detonate explosives.
The report noted that Twitter members reported the July Los Angeles earthquake faster than news outlets and activists at the Republican National Convention in Minneapolis used it to provide information on police movements. I might note that forty years ago amateur radio operators faced the same charges, providing information on movement of antiwar demonstrators.
It looks to me that in case of terrorist activity that you would want the terrorists to use Twitter – and push their communications into the open for easy monitoring and tracking.
So if the technical reason is shaky, why the report ? Nothing more powerful than linking a technology with a boogeyman. In case you need to show you were on top of your game.
